Level 2 Understanding Domestic Retrofit
Enhance your skills and career with our Level 2 Understanding Domestic Retrofit course, designed to provide you with essential knowledge and practical expertise in retrofitting residential properties for improved energy efficiency. This course covers key areas such as insulation, heating systems, renewable energy technologies and energy performance assessments, equipping you to make homes more energy-efficient and sustainable.

Who Is This For
The Level 2 Understanding Domestic Retrofit course is designed for individuals looking to expand their knowledge and skills in the retrofitting and energy efficiency sector. It is ideal for aspiring retrofit specialists, tradespeople such as electricians, plumbers, and heating engineers as well as energy efficiency professionals seeking to deepen their expertise in residential energy improvements. Property developers, landlords and environmental consultants will also benefit from this course by gaining a understanding of sustainable retrofit solutions.
Mandatory Units
Learners must complete the mandatory units
- Domestic Retrofit Information
- Health & Safety
- Retrofit Material
- Protecting the Work Area
- Information Specific to Contracts
- Installation Processes
How You Will Learn
This course is online via Teams and will consist of up to 30 learning hours.
A small quiz is to be completed after each module and a multiple choice end test after the last unit is required to pass the qualification.
Learners will be awarded the NOCN Level 2 Understanding Domestic Retrofit Award
Eligibility
- There are no formal entry requirements for learners undertaking this qualification, however, experience in the construction industry would be a benefit.
